Pumpkin Seed
The seed's phytosterols slow 5-alpha-reductase, the enzyme that makes DHT. Less enzyme working, less DHT coming out.
Saw Palmetto
The liposterolic extract occupies the follicle's receptor: the DHT that's left has nowhere to latch on. And it slows the enzyme too.
